A falconer of 23 years believes the ancient art could help protect our native raptor population, and tackle pest problems.

Aotearoa has three native birds of prey: the ruru, the swamp harrier (kahu) and the New Zealand falcon (kārearea.)

Chris Brook is the co-founder of Kahu Conservation, a rehabilitation centre specialising in raptors.  He talks to Jesse about how the birds can play a part in protecting our native bird life.
